Sec. 42-52. - Adjustment of water and sewer bills.

(a) In the event a water user receives a substantially higher water bill than is usual for said customer and it is determined that the excess usage was the likely result of a leak or break on the user's side of the water meter, and the water user provides appropriate evidence that such leak or break has been corrected, either by evidence of a paid receipt for the repair or evidence that water usage has returned to normal, the city manager or a person designated by the city manager shall have the power to review and adjust the water and sewer bill of the customer to an amount equaling the average water and sewer bill incurred by the user during the preceding three-month period plus the actual cost of water and sewer that flowed thru the meter. In the event the water user does not have a three-month use history at the location in question, other equitable adjustments may be considered in accordance with the spirit of this subsection at the discretion of the city manager or a person designated by the city manager. Substantially higher shall be defined as a monthly usage exceeding two and one-half times the average water usage of the last three months of billing. No sewer adjustment shall be considered for a winter average customer.

(b) When residential customers have excessive metered water usage that could not reasonably be expected to have entered the sanitary sewer system, the city manager or a person designated by the city manager shall have the authority to adjust the sanitary sewer charge to an amount equaling the average sewer bill incurred by the user during the preceding three-month period. In the event the customer does not have a three-month use history at the location in question, other equitable adjustments may be considered in accordance with the spirit of this subsection at the discretion of the city manager or a person designated by the city manager. Excessive water usage shall be defined as a monthly usage exceeding two and one-half times the average water usage of the last three months of billing. No sewer adjustment shall be considered for a winter average customer.

(c) Any customer who is unhappy with the administrative decision may appeal to the city council.
